Situated in Le Mans, France, Akiolis Group SAS is a specialist in processing animal by-products into high-value fats, proteins and organic materials. As part of Belgium’s Tessenderlo Group, Akiolis operates roughly a dozen processing plants and some 48 collection centers across Europe .

It “produces high-value ingredients from animal materials not consumed by humans” as a core mission, embedding itself in a zero-waste circular economy . In practice, the company refines waste into bioenergy and bio-chemicals, directly supporting EU climate and resource goals . For example, Akiolis’s processes allow its recovered proteins and fats to substitute imports like fishmeal and palm oil .
